> So, I have this tabbed interface which has to fit in a quite small
> space; the problem is that the titles of the tabs can get quite long
> and, while testing it for now they all fit, in case one would need to
> add more tabs in a second moment, they would overflow from the space I
> designed for them.
> I thought of having a sort of "tabbed tab menu", so to speak: what I
> mean is that I need to display more tabs then it fits, so I thought of
> having a "Next" or "Previous" tab which gives you a new set of menu
> items which you can choose from.
> The problems are two: one is that if you select Tab-A from the "first
> page menu", then scroll to the "second page menu" and select Tab-B,
> scrolling back to the first page menu will still obviously give Tab-A
> as selected. The second would be that accessing the page with a cross-
> link to the tab, will most likely not display the selected tab
> correctly: if I use a direct link to the page say to #Tab-B which is
> in the "second page menu" (which is itself another tab fragment), it
> will correctly display my page, but it will be displaying the "first
> page menu".
